1. Updating and Upgrading Your External Links

In Google’s new search algorithm, a special accent will be placed on authority and credibility. This means that websites which search engines deem to be more credible will appear in the top results (scientific journals, professional websites, expert blogs, etc.)

In order to make sure your website is up there with them, check that your links are pointing to high-authority websites.

“At my company, we use Google Scholar to find high-authority, scientific sources to back up our arguments and claims. The nifty thing about Scholar is that, just like Google, you can search through billions of scientific papers using a keyword, and the results are extremely relevant”, says Jane Merill, an essay writer at WowGrade.

Another announcement about Google’s Bert algorithm explained that the search engine will recognize the relevancy of the external link’s anchor to the content that it’s pointing to. This will prevent disguised hidden links, spam websites and other black hat SEO techniques. So, when you do point to authoritative sites from your website, make sure it’s in a relevant context.

Visual media and content have ruled in 2019, and it’s expected to be even more significant in 2020. In order to keep up with the trends and provide a wide array of content categories for your audience, you need to branch out from writing alone.

Video is the second most used content source after blog posts, both in the B2C and B2B domain. It’s especially important when you are developing your Instagram marketing strategy.

According to HubSpot Research, video has the highest engagement rate than all other content types. The research has showed that 62% of respondents thoroughly consume video content, as opposed to 57% for multimedia articles and 27% for blog posts.

If you are a blogger or a writer, of course, web content creation should remain your primary focus. However, if you want to make the content on your website more dynamic and versatile, you can add videos and audio versions of your articles to cover a wider audience base.
